Iraq Veterans Against the War Descends on Denver to Call on Democrats to Endorse True Antiwar Platform

On Monday, IVAW delivered a letter to Senator Barack Obama’s DNC campaign headquarters asking that he endorse the organization’s three main points: the immediate withdrawal of all occupying forces from Iraq, full and adequate healthcare and benefits to all returning service members and veterans, and reparations made to the Iraqi people for the destruction caused by the US war and occupation. This weekend here in Denver, Amy Goodman caught up with IVAW member Sgt. Matthis Chiroux, who served in the US Army for five years and a few months ago publicly refused to deploy to Iraq, subjecting him to risk of prosecution. [includes rush transcript]
